Output 8b968aa4a282bb8756b5128b0dbf0d7d5d09378d53b6b614ba221ec665db90c5:1

value
18330226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c166058aa9d1dec1e657cdde400701f688a95c6e OP_EQUAL
address
3KKcZ9xoVMYdZDLgVX1bUqNCgp7bfcR1hG
transaction
8b968aa4a282bb8756b5128b0dbf0d7d5d09378d53b6b614ba221ec665db90c5
confirmations
238264
spent
true